Sometimes I take it for granted and have to explain that meat on a grill is grilling and not BBQ. In October 2015, my first stop in Austin    Franklin Barbecue Bucket list item... With friends, we arrived at 9:15 am. They open at 11 am. We ate by 1 pm or so. They were SOLD OUT by 1:30 pm. And they do this everyday, except Mondays.  Why do they show up and wait? For me, it was the brisket. The Best Brisket I've ever had, Period. Franklin Barbecue doesn't have any Michelin stars, but I did see a few Michelin tires in the parking lot... (they're on the list now) BUT, on my trip to Austin last month, I did go to Valentina's Tex Mex BBQ Valentina's Tex Mex BBQ in Austin, TX can be found in a gas station parking lot. I already knew this would be good...  It wasn't a hard decision, being in Texas, had to get a brisket taco first... See What Jay Eats... Cowboy Taco (Left) and Brisket Taco The Cowboy Taco had pulled pork, house slaw, and BBQ sauce. The Brisket Taco comes with sliced brisket, tangy slaw, and of course BBQ sauce.
